I'm trying to use my Atralin several times a week and really loving the way my skin is looking but it's very sensitized and peels.

 

My normal products are Vivite which is a medical grade line that contains Glycolic & Salicylic so I can't use them while using Atralin.

 

I got CeraVe and really like it BUT it does not remove the Heavy Make-up I wear to cover my acne & pigmentation issues. I even read a product review about it and they said the same thing. Not good to remove make-up.

 

I need something that is gentle but will get my make-up off at Night and then I can use the CeraVe in the Morning.

Which CeraVe do you use? I have had good luck using the foaming one to remove makeup. I found the moisturizing one wasn't as good.

Oh yea I'm using the moisturizing cleanser. I cleansed Two times and still when I did my toner there was foundation all over the cotton. I'll try the foaming one.

 

And Green Gables.... I'm an oil-phobic! Haha! I know some oils are ok for acne prone but I still just can't bring myself to do it. I'd be scared to use those cuz they list olive oil. What do you think about olive oil? Dermalogica makes a product called Precleanse that is made with olive oil and is meant to be a 1st cleanse, then you do a 2nd cleanse with a regular cleanser. When I used that it clogged my pores.

 

I've been wanting to "try" jojoba oil cuz I know that one is good for oily skin but I'm still scared. lol
